在临床上治疗牙列缺损,尤其是后牙游离端缺失时,有时会考虑使用天然牙与种植体联合支持式固定义齿修复方案.虽然这是一种有争议的方案,有很多研究报道了它的临床并发症和不足之处;但同时也有很多研究表明其具有很好的临床效果.本文从生物力学研究和临床应用两个方面对有关天然牙与种植体联合支持式固定义齿修复的研究现状进行综述.  相似文献

1 Background

Computer‐guided systems were developed to facilitate implant placement at optimal positions in relation to the future prosthesis. However, the time, cost and, technique sensitivity involved with computer‐guided surgery impedes its routine practice. The aim of this study is to evaluate survival rates and complications associated with computer‐guided versus conventional implant placement in implant‐retained hybrid prostheses. Furthermore, long‐term economic efficiency of this approach was assessed.

2 Methods

Patients were stratified according to implant placement protocol into a test group, using computer‐guided placement, and a control group, using traditional placement. Calibrated radiographs were used to measure bone loss around implants. Furthermore, the costs of the initial treatment and prosthetic complications, if any, were standardized and analyzed.

3 Results

Forty‐five patients (149 implants in the test group and 111 implants in the control group) with a minimum follow‐up of 5 years, and a mean follow‐up of 9.6 years, were included in the study. While no significant difference was found between both groups in terms of biologic and technical complications, lower incidence of implant loss was observed in the test group (< 0.001). A statistically significant difference in favor of the non‐guided implant placement group was found for the initial cost (< 0.05) but not for the prosthetic complications and total cost (> 0.05).

4 Conclusions

Computer‐guided implant placement for an implant‐supported hybrid prosthesis is a valid, reliable alternative to the traditional approach for implant placement and immediate loading. Computer‐guided implant placement showed higher implant survival rates and comparable long‐term cost to non‐guided implant placement.  相似文献
